FCOE BOOT FROM SAN
This section describes the install and boot procedures for the Windows, Linux, ESX, and Solaris operating systems.
NOTE: FCoE Boot from SAN is not supported on ESXi 5.0. ESX Boot from SAN is supported on ESXi 5.1 and
above.
The following section details the BIOS setup and configuration of the boot environment prior to the OS install.
PREPARING SYSTEM BIOS FOR FCOE BUILD AND BOOT
Modify System Boot Order
The Broadcom initiator must be the first entry in the system boot order. The second entry must be the OS installation media.
It is important that the boot order be set correctly or else the installation will not proceed correctly. Either the desired boot
LUN will not be discovered or it will be discovered but marked offline.
Specify BIOS Boot Protocol (if required)
On some platforms, the The boot protocol must be configured through system BIOS configuration. On all other systems the
boot protocol is specified through the Broadcom Comprehensive Configuration Management (CCM), and for those systems
this step is not required.
